Consiglio's Restaurant (New Haven)

What to Expect

Four-course Italian cooking demonstrations with chef-prepared meals

Description

Chef Ray Gennaro hosts intimate four-course cooking demonstrations at Consiglio's Restaurant, offering guests a hands-on culinary experience. Participants learn gourmet Italian recipes while enjoying a full dinner, complete with a take-home recipe booklet that captures each evening's unique menu.

Fire by Forge (Hartford)

What to Expect

Mystery ingredient basket cooking competition

Description

Fire by Forge offers competitive, hands-on culinary team-building experiences in Hartford. Participants divide into teams to create three-course meals using mystery ingredient baskets, transforming cooking into an interactive Iron Chef-style challenge that emphasizes collaboration and creativity.

The Fig Cooking School (Milford)

What to Expect

Communal dinner following hands-on international cooking workshops

Description

The Fig Cooking School offers hands-on culinary classes in an intimate setting for 12-20 guests, featuring seasonal and international cuisine. Each three-hour workshop concludes with a communal dinner where participants enjoy the dishes they've prepared, exploring global recipes from Rome to Baja California.

Weekend Kitchen (West Hartford)

What to Expect

Community-focused cooking workshops with professional local chefs

Description

Weekend Kitchen offers hands-on, 3-hour cooking classes led by local professional chefs in West Hartford. Participants collaboratively prepare meals in an interactive environment, with a social atmosphere that encourages connection through cooking. Classes range from international cuisines to specialized techniques, welcoming participants to bring their own beverages.
